Travelling from Hamilton Island Airport (HTI) to Sydney (Kingsford Smith) Airport (SYD): what you need to know
Around 2 hours 20 minutes is how long you can expect to be travelling on a direct flight from Hamilton Island Airport to Sydney (Kingsford Smith) Airport.
The timezone in Sydney is UTC+11, which is one hour ahead of Hamilton Island.
You can choose from 194 weekly Hamilton Island Airport to Sydney (Kingsford Smith) Airport flights. The 11:45 departure with Qantas is the earliest you can take. Virgin Australia Regional operates the last service of the day at 15:25.

Handy information about Hamilton Island Airport (HTI)
66.24% of flights taking off from Hamilton Island Airport touch down at their destination on schedule.
Central Hamilton Island to Hamilton Island Airport is approximately 3 kilometres. Depending on traffic, it'll take you about 10 minutes to get there if you're ride-sharing, catching a cab or driving.
The journey on public transport typically takes 45 minutes.

Getting from Sydney (Kingsford Smith) Airport (SYD) to central Sydney
From Sydney (Kingsford Smith) Airport, Sydney is approximately 18 kilometres away. It takes around 20 minutes to reach the centre by car.
Travelling to the centre by public transport takes around 25 minutes.

Explore more of Australia
Sydney has its own special appeal, but there are so many other parts of Australia waiting to be explored. Around 241 kilometres south-west of Sydney, a trip to Canberra will fill your itinerary to the brim. Check out popular attractions like Australian War Memorial, National Gallery of Australia and Parliament House.
Around 121 kilometres north-east of Sydney, Newcastle is another favourite stop in Australia. No visit is complete without checking out Newcastle Beach, Nobbys Beach and Merewether Beach.
